Chemistry and more with egg whites

Chemistry and more with egg whites

15 April 2019. Sixth-grade student Erika suggested that we try an experiment to see how fast an enzyme, pepsin, can break down egg white protein.  Pepsin is a protease, which breaks bonds in proteins by hydrolysis, adding water to the peptide bond between amino acids...

Science demo at the Space Festival

Science demo at the Space Festival

13 April 2019, at the Las Cruces International Space Festival on the plaza: Vince Gutschick, Board Chair and teacher at the Las Cruces Academy, met LCA graduate Arabella.  They joined in a brief demo of the force of atmospheric pressure, using a small Magdeburg sphere...
